Бившият британски протекторат на Barotseland willingly chose to become part of Замбия в съответствие с Споразумение Бароцеланд 1964, a treaty brokered by the United Kingdom that was intended to preserve Barotseland’s semi-autonomous status within an independent Zambia.
Въпреки че Кенет Каунда, първият президент на Замбия, signed the treaty himself on behalf of the Government of Northern Rhodesia, he and the Zambian Government would violate every provision of the Barotseland Agreement 1964 започвайки скоро след независимостта на Замбия, going so far as to modify the Zambian Constitution to remove all references to the Barotseland Agreement 1964, да се “анулира” the British act of parliament granting sovereignty to Zambia which referred to the Barotseland Agreement 1964, за отчуждаване на съкровищницата на Бароцеланд, to changing the name of Barotseland to the generic “Западен регион” and attempting to destroy Barotseland’s previously well-functioning institutions.
Разбираемо, в 2012, на Barotseland National Council voted to accept Zambia’s abrogation of the Barotseland Agreement 1964, with the logical consequence that Barotseland had regained its independence since the treaty by which it freely forged a union with Zambia had ended. Още, вместо да води диалог Замбия увеличи репресиите в бившия британски протекторат на Бароцеланд, imprisoning dozens of Barotseland activists on the charge of treason and increasing the police presence in Barotseland while refusing to consider Barotseland’s calls for the peaceful resolution of the issue of Barotseland’s legal status by way of PCA арбитраж в Хага.

Към днешна дата, приблизително 10,000 Представителите на Barotseland подписаха споразумение за арбитраж на PCA designed to allow an independent and neutral arbitral tribunal in The Hague to rule upon the status of the Barotseland Agreement 1964 в съответствие с международното право. President Sata of Zambia has steadfastly refused to sign the PCA arbitration agreement, in an apparent recognition that Zambia’s acts flagrantly violated the treaty.
